Veterans Education (VetEd) Reimbursement Grant (VetEd Grant)
Reimburses tuition and fees for successfully completed courses at UW System schools, Wisconsin technical colleges, or approved private schools. Total semesters or credits allowed depend on your length of active duty service, up to 8 semesters or 120 credits.
Who it is for
Wisconsin veterans who do not yet have a bachelor's degree, keep at least a 2.0 GPA each semester, and have household income below $50,000 plus $1,000 for each dependent beyond two. Veterans eligible for the Wisconsin GI Bill must apply for and use that benefit first.

How to apply
- Apply online through MyWisVets.com, or download and submit WDVA Form 2200.
- Make sure WDVA receives your application within 60 days of the course start date.
- Your County or Tribal Veterans Service Officer can help you apply for free; you can also call 800-947-8387.
Deadline: You apply each term. WDVA must receive your application within 60 days of the course start date. (Rolling, apply any time)
